#8That said, my experience indicates that this is not going to convert well.
To mirror the author's own quote:
"Every question a user has to ask themselves during the checkout process is another reason for them not to complete it."
What's presented here is a drastically different experience from the norm.
It doesn't behave the way you'd expect if you've ever bought anything else online.
Beyond that it has to load images dynamically based on card type which, on a slow or interrupted connection, will create even more confusion.
I love the concept, I love the execution, I just don't think this is going to be a conversion driver.
